OUR MISSION IS:

Special Equestrians of the Treasure Coast fosters personal achievement through equine assisted activities for individuals with special needs in a safe and stimulating environment.

A PLACE TO CALL HOME

Our potential new home will bring numerous benefits to the community:

  • Enhanced Accessibility: The adaptive riding center, complete with covered arena, will be designed to accommodate children and adults with special needs, ensuring everyone can participate in equine-assisted activities.

  • Improved Services: With the new space, SETC will be able to expand and enhance their Equine Assisted Services, providing better support and resources.

  • Community Support: The facility will attract volunteers and donors, fostering a strong sense of community involvement and support.

  • Therapeutic Benefits: Participants will gain physical, emotional, and social benefits from engaging with the horses and the supportive environment.

Our new home for SETC will have a positive impact on many lives.
